Around South Killingly 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Providence (RI). It is located about 21 miles [33 km] to the east of South Killingly. Providence (RI) has a population of 179,000 people.<1>.

The next largest community is Warwick (RI). It is located about 22 miles [ km] to the east of South Killingly and has a population of 81,200 people.

Windham County ...

South Killingly is located in Windham County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Windham County: New London, Tolland, Worcester (MA), Kent (RI) & Providence (RI).
